I know this isn't directed at me, but PTBNL usually aren't anything significant. The Sox have a list of possible guys they are allowed to choose from the Red Sox. Likely low minors lottery tickets. Trea Turner is the last big PTBNL to be traded, but MLB changed the rules following that deal, and we're well beyond the new deadline for drafted players to be traded.
